A Summary condenses content to main points; a Paraphrase rewords text while maintaining the original meaning.
Summary vs. Paraphrase

Key Differences

A Summary aims to condense the main points of a text, focusing on core ideas and omitting details. Paraphrase, however, rewords the text while preserving the original meaning, often maintaining the same level of detail.

Summaries are typically shorter than the original text, capturing only essential information. Paraphrases, on the other hand, can be similar in length to the original, as they involve rephrasing rather than condensing.

A Summary is used to provide a brief overview of a larger text, useful in research and academic writing. Paraphrasing is employed to avoid plagiarism, showing understanding of the source material without copying verbatim.

In a Summary, the writer's voice predominates, presenting the main ideas in a concise form. In Paraphrasing, the original style and tone can be retained, but with different word choices and sentence structures.

Summaries help in understanding the gist of a text, useful in studying and communicating key points. Paraphrasing aids in comprehension and reiteration of ideas, crucial for effective communication and writing.

A restatement of a text, passage, or work, expressing the meaning of the original in another form, generally for the sake of its clearer and fuller exposition; a setting forth the signification of a text in other and ampler terms; a free translation or rendering; - opposed to metaphrase.
In paraphrase, or translation with latitude, the author's words are not so strictly followed as his sense.
Excellent paraphrases of the Psalms of David.
His sermons a living paraphrase upon his practice.
The Targums are also called the Chaldaic or Aramaic Paraphrases.
